Summary
The SAG-AFTRA National Board has decisively approved the tentative agreement reached with the AMPTP, sending the new deal to union membership for a ratification vote. The board is recommending a "yes" vote to its members, marking a significant step toward ending the labor negotiations between the actors' union and major studios.
